🛑Stop Unauthorized Brand Name Changes [Quick Guide] 🛑
Hello Sellers!
We know protecting your brand matters. Here's a simple guide to reporting unauthorized brand name changes on your ASINs. This information was posted here previously but I want to resurface as it's important.
When Can You Use This Process?
If you're the Trademark/Brand owner and someone changed your ASIN's brand name without permission, follow these three steps to submit a complaint.
1. Click "Report Abuse" on the product detail page
2. Select "Product detail page was changed to represent a different product"
3. Include helpful details like when you created the ASIN and what the original brand name was
Important: This process doesn't cover...
- Revoked brands – If your brand was removed from Brand Registry, you'll need to appeal and restore it first before trying to restore the brand names.
- Generic to branded changes – We can't change Generic brand names to registered brands (see our Brand Name Policy for details)
- Your own brand updates – If you created the ASIN under a different brand and want to change this to another brand name. (see our Brand Name Policy for details)
What Happens Next?
We're actively reviewing these reports and working to resolve them faster. If your report gets declined, don't worry. Just create a discussion in the "Manage Your Brand" category with your complaint ID, and we'll follow up on your thread as soon as possible.
